Sure. Here's the analysis:
Job Analysis:
The role of Software Engineer Technical Lead at Generali Global Assistance (GGA) is fundamentally designed to steer the engineering team towards the successful development and deployment of software solutions that underpin their Travel Insurance platforms. This involves not just writing code but also setting a technical vision through leadership while ensuring the delivery aligns with business needs. Key responsibilities encompass leading a diverse team in a collaborative environment and engaging with multiple stakeholders, which implies that the candidate must excel in communicating technical concepts to both technical and business-oriented team members. The role leans heavily on their ability to innovate—creating solutions that enhance customer experience—while maintaining operational quality and performance. A successful candidate will have to balance numerous priorities, from mentoring junior developers to troubleshooting complex system issues, highlighting the need for both technical prowess and effective team leadership in a high-stakes environment.
Company Analysis:
Generali Global Assistance occupies a pivotal role in the travel and assistance insurance industry and is a part of the well-established Generali Group, offering over 190 years of history. This positioning suggests that GGA is a stable player with a strong reputation, yet one that is also evolving to meet modern demands, particularly in the face of digital transformation and changing customer expectations. Understanding this dynamic is crucial—success in the role requires not only technical skills but the capacity to innovate in a way that reinforces the company's commitment to customer-centric service. The culture likely emphasizes collaboration and diversity, important factors in fostering innovative solutions and equipping employees to handle stress effectively. The Technical Lead will find themselves at the nexus of various teams, underscoring the importance of cross-functional engagement and the ability to navigate complexity and ambiguity in operational circumstances. With a hybrid work model in place, the role provides flexibility while still necessitating effective onsite collaboration, indicating that interpersonal skills are just as critical as technical capabilities for achieving company goals.